Output eb73e4395693d457503b34068d686d55e75b899da520f8666df453d4129f1f23:0

value
598392000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d91635ae61be78bacf4c4a3eaf340d374bf7486 OP_EQUALVERIFY OP_CHECKSIG
address
1JHLszvQEE2NgU2JWnqe8A9AfFk7b4UweR
transaction
eb73e4395693d457503b34068d686d55e75b899da520f8666df453d4129f1f23
spent
true